WebA small needle is inserted into the trigger point. An injection of an anesthetic or mixture of anesthetics, with a corticosteroid added sometimes, is made directly into the trigger point via the needle. Sometimes a needle is inserted without medication, or only a saline solution is administered, with the goal to make the trigger point inactive. WebTrigger Point Injections for Pain Management. Trigger point injections (TPIs) are a type of injection used to treat muscle pain and stiffness. A trigger point is a tight band of muscle tissue that can be painful when pressed. These points can cause pain in other parts of the body and can be triggered by physical activity, stress, or other factors.
